How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Pella?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Pella Studio Apartments | $725 | $725 | $725 |
Pella 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,266 | $685 | $2,379 |
Pella 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,173 | $695 | $3,193 |
Pella 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,287 | $536 | $2,731 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pella
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Pella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Pella ranges from $685 to $2,379 with an average monthly rent of $1,266.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Pella c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Pella range from $695 to $3,193.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,173.
How expensive are Pella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Pella on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$536 to $2,731 - averaging $1,287 for the location.
